How It Works

Legal DNA test – when needing a DNA test for paternity, child custody or any court ordered purpose a legal DNA test must be performed at a testing center, the child/children and the alleged father will be scheduled to go to one of our many testing centers nationwide with appropriate documentation, identification, and the test will be performed by a qualified DNA test collector who will then send the specimen to a certified AABB laboratory. Results will be available in approximately 10 days after the laboratory receives the specimen.

Non-legal DNA test -this test is performed for informational purposes only, a DNA certified test kit will be sent to the purchaser via regular mail or overnight delivery. The kit will include clear instructions of how to perform the DNA test, the purchaser will utilize an oral fluid swab for the child/children and alleged father. upon completion the specimen will be placed in a prepaid delivery envelope and sent to our AABB certified laboratory. Results will be available in approximately 10 days after the specimens are received at the laboratory. Please remember the non-legal DNA test cannot be used in a court of law or for any legal purpose.

Common Reasons for DNA Testing in Alcolu

Establishing parentage for custody/support.
DNA profiling provides conclusive evidence in custody or support disputes, ensuring court-admissible genetic proof of parentage. With precision, it aids judges in delivering fair decisions regarding parental duties and financial support obligations.

Confirming familial relationships.
Through genetic markers, DNA tests uncover and confirm familial links, providing certainty about siblings, grandparents, and beyond. The trusted results can alleviate inheritance disagreements and promote familial unity based on verified biological facts.

Immigration cases requiring proof of biological relationships.
DNA analysis is crucial for immigration, offering indisputable proof of biological ties required for visa and citizenship endorsements. Legally recognized DNA tests aid in family reunification, minimizing processing delays and streamlining immigration proceedings.

Adoption cases or identifying unknown biological relatives.
Genetic genealogy and DNA health testing empower adoptees to connect with unknown biological relatives, enriching their understanding of genetic ancestry. This provides a sense of closure, reveals vital health information, and completes personal identity quests.

Genealogy and ancestry exploration.
By analyzing genetic markers, ancestry testing delivers insights into one's ethnic origins and ancestral background. It deepens connections with cultural roots, outlines historical migration journeys, and fosters family heritage exploration through genetic genealogy.
